可视化大屏是一种基于数据可视化技术的显示系统,通过将复杂的数据转化为直观的图表、图形和动态交互界面,为企业提供高效的数据决策支持。在国企中,可视化大屏通常用于监控企业运营指标、展示项目进展、分析财务数据等场景。
数据中台是企业数字化转型的重要基础设施,它通过整合、存储和处理企业内外部数据,为上层应用提供数据支持。可视化大屏作为数据中台的典型应用场景,能够将数据中台处理后的结果以直观的方式呈现,帮助企业快速理解数据价值。
数字孪生是一种通过数字模型实时反映物理世界的技术。将数字孪生与可视化大屏结合,可以在大屏幕上实时展示物理设备的状态、运行数据以及环境变化,为企业提供高度智能化的监控和决策能力。
可视化大屏需要处理多种数据源,包括数据库、API接口、文件数据等。国企通常涉及大量结构化数据(如财务报表)和非结构化数据(如文本报告),因此数据源的多样性是开发过程中的重要挑战。
在接入数据后,需要进行数据清洗和整合,确保数据的准确性和一致性。例如,通过数据转换规则将不同部门的数据格式统一,避免因数据不一致导致的可视化错误。
根据数据类型和应用场景选择合适的可视化方式。例如,使用柱状图展示趋势变化,使用热力图展示区域分布,使用仪表盘展示关键指标。
可视化大屏需要支持用户与数据的交互,例如缩放、筛选、钻取等操作。通过动态交互,用户可以更深入地探索数据。
常用的前端框架包括React、Vue等。这些框架提供了丰富的组件库和开发工具,能够快速构建复杂的可视化界面。
后端通常使用Spring Boot、Django等框架,负责处理数据接口和业务逻辑。后端与前端通过RESTful API进行通信,确保数据的实时性和可靠性。
国企数据涉及敏感信息,因此在开发过程中需要严格控制数据访问权限,防止数据泄露。
通过缓存、分布式计算等技术优化大屏的响应速度和负载能力,确保在高并发场景下仍能稳定运行。
在开发前,需要与业务部门充分沟通,明确大屏的功能需求、使用场景和用户群体。
根据需求设计大屏的界面布局,包括颜色 scheme、图表样式、交互按钮等。设计稿需要经过多次评审,确保与业务目标一致。
通过JDBC或ORM工具将大屏与企业数据库对接,确保数据的实时更新。
如果数据来自外部系统,需要开发API接口实现数据的实时调用。
使用ECharts、D3.js等工具开发定制化的图表组件,满足特定业务需求。
开发动态交互功能,例如点击图表某部分后跳转到详细页面,或筛选数据后更新图表。
对大屏的各项功能进行测试,确保数据展示准确、交互响应灵敏。
在高并发场景下测试大屏的性能,确保系统稳定运行。
将大屏部署到企业内部服务器或云平台,确保访问权限控制和数据安全。
通过可视化大屏,国企能够快速获取关键业务指标,减少数据报表的分析时间,提升决策效率。
可视化大屏可以实时监控资源使用情况,帮助企业发现资源浪费问题,优化资源配置。
在数字化转型的大背景下,可视化大屏能够提升国企的智能化水平,增强企业在市场中的竞争力。
未来的可视化大屏将更加智能化,能够自动识别数据趋势,提供智能推荐和预警功能。
随着移动设备的普及,可视化大屏将支持更多终端设备,例如手机、平板电脑等。
通过与人工智能技术结合,可视化大屏能够实现数据的自动分析和预测,为决策提供更强大的支持。
为了更好地实践可视化大屏的开发,您可以申请试用DTStack大数据平台,体验其强大的数据处理和可视化功能。通过DTStack,您可以轻松实现数据中台和数字孪生的构建,为企业数字化转型提供有力支持。
申请试用:DTStack大数据平台
申请试用&下载资料